✦ Synopsis


99 Tc mixed-ligand complexes displaying characteristic substitution-inert metal-fragments are emerging as alternative platforms in the design of potential 99m Tc radiopharmaceuticals. Starting from the already well-known [Tc(CO) 3 ] + moiety, this review describes recent efforts in the coordination chemistry of technetium aiming at the exploitation of the metal-fragment strategy. Examples include Tc III '4 + 1' and Tc III 'SSS' systems, along with a description of the Tc V (N)(PNP) system and the transfer of this technology to other cores (M NPh and M O).
